Movement Precision and Mechanical Core

A watch only fulfills its primary purpose if it keeps accurate time consistently. Michael Kors equips this green dial series with precise quartz movements, known for their exceptional reliability and minimal maintenance. Users benefit from immediate, accurate timekeeping straight from the box, without the winding requirements of mechanical alternatives. This makes the watch an ideal choice for someone who values punctuality without wanting to manage the daily ritual of keeping an automatic watch wound.

Quartz technology also delivers consistent accuracy across extended periods of wear. The movement is powered by a standard battery that typically lasts multiple years before replacement. This low-intervention approach suits a modern lifestyle, where convenience and dependability rank as high priorities. The internal components are shielded within the robust stainless steel case, protecting the delicate mechanisms from everyday shocks and minor impacts.

Including features such as a chronograph function on certain models adds another practical dimension to this piece. The stop-watch complication allows for easily timing meetings, professional tasks, or fitness intervals directly from the wrist. These additional sub-dials integrate seamlessly into the green canvas, preserving the dial’s cohesive visual character while increasing its utility. Materials, Craftsmanship, and Day-to-Day Wear

The choice of build materials directly influences how a watch ages and feels during daily wear. A stainless steel case provides a solid, reassuring weight without being excessively heavy, striking the ideal balance for all-day comfort. The bracelet iterations use links that articulate smoothly, conforming to the wrist shape and preventing skin pinching. Each link is finished to reduce sharp edges, a detail that reflects attention to wearability.

Water resistance adds peace of mind for moments such as hand washing or unexpected rain exposure. While not a professional dive instrument, this level of protection safeguards the intricate dial and movement during routine life moments. The mineral crystal covering the dial resists scratches from casual bumps against desks or countertops, maintaining visual clarity over the life of the timepiece. A deployment clasp or traditional buckle secures the watch reliably, reducing the risk of accidental loss.
